本系统(程序+源码)带文档lw万字以上 文末可获取一份本项目的java源码和数据库参考。
系统程序文件列表
开题报告内容
一、研究背景
随着社会经济的发展和人们文化素养的不断提高,艺术品市场呈现出蓬勃发展的态势。艺术品的种类日益繁多,包括绘画、雕塑、书法、古董等多种形式。然而,当前艺术品管理面临着诸多挑战。一方面,艺术品的数量庞大且来源广泛,传统的管理方式难以满足高效管理的需求。另一方面,艺术品市场的信息不透明,使得买家和卖家在交易过程中存在信息不对称的问题。此外,艺术品的真伪鉴定、价值评估等也缺乏统一的标准和有效的管理手段。在数字化时代背景下,构建一个艺术品信息管理系统成为解决这些问题的迫切需求,它能够借助信息技术对艺术品进行全面、系统、高效的管理,提高艺术品管理的科学性和准确性,促进艺术品市场的健康发展。
二、研究意义
艺术品信息管理系统的设计与实现具有多方面的重要意义。首先,对于艺术品市场而言,该系统能够提高市场的透明度,让买家和卖家能够更加准确地获取艺术品的相关信息,如艺术品的来源、历史交易记录、鉴定结果等,从而促进艺术品交易的公平性和公正性,减少欺诈行为的发生。其次,对于艺术品收藏者和爱好者来说,系统方便他们对自己所拥有的艺术品进行管理,同时也能让他们更便捷地了解艺术品市场的动态,发现自己感兴趣的艺术品。再者,从文化传承的角度看,该系统有助于对各类艺术品信息进行整合和保存,防止文化遗产信息的丢失,为后人研究和欣赏艺术品提供丰富的资料。
三、研究目的
本研究的目的在于设计并实现一个功能完善的艺术品信息管理系统。通过该系统能够实现对艺术品信息的有效整合与管理,包括艺术品的基本信息、所属类别、交易信息等。同时,系统要满足不同用户的需求,如艺术品商家、收藏者、鉴定者等,为他们提供便捷的操作界面和准确的信息服务。此外,还要确保系统的安全性和可靠性,保护艺术品相关信息的隐私和完整性,并且通过系统的统计中心功能,能够为艺术品市场的发展趋势分析提供数据支持。
四、研究内容
- 用户管理功能:
- 用户注册与登录:设计安全可靠的注册与登录机制,确保用户信息的安全性。用户可以通过多种方式进行注册,如手机号码、电子邮箱等,并设置密码。登录时需要验证用户名和密码的准确性。
- 用户权限管理:根据不同类型的用户(如管理员、普通用户、商家等)设置不同的权限。管理员具有最高权限,可以对整个系统进行管理,包括用户管理、艺术品信息管理等;普通用户可以浏览艺术品信息、进行搜索等操作;商家则可以上传艺术品信息、管理自己的商品列表等。
- 用户信息维护:用户可以对自己的个人信息进行修改,如联系方式、地址等。同时,系统也会记录用户的操作历史,方便用户查询自己的操作记录。
- 艺术品管理功能:
- 艺术品信息录入:商家或管理员可以录入艺术品的详细信息,如艺术品的名称、作者、创作年代、尺寸、材质、描述等。同时,还可以上传艺术品的图片,以便用户更好地查看艺术品的外观。
- 艺术品信息查询与展示:用户可以根据不同的条件(如艺术品名称、作者、类别等)对艺术品进行查询,系统将展示符合条件的艺术品信息。查询结果可以按照一定的规则进行排序,如按照价格、创作年代等。
- 艺术品交易管理:对于可交易的艺术品,系统要支持交易流程的管理,包括订单生成、支付处理、物流跟踪等环节。同时,还要记录艺术品的交易历史,方便查询和统计。
- 艺术品分类功能:
- 分类标准制定:根据艺术品的不同属性,制定科学合理的分类标准。例如,可以按照艺术形式(绘画、雕塑、书法等)、艺术风格(写实主义、抽象主义等)、年代(古代、近代、现代等)等进行分类。
- 分类管理:管理员可以对艺术品进行分类操作,将艺术品归入相应的类别中。同时,系统也支持用户根据分类进行筛选查询,提高用户查找艺术品的效率。
- 统计中心功能:
- 数据统计:对艺术品的相关数据进行统计,如艺术品的数量、不同类别艺术品的比例、交易金额的分布等。这些统计数据可以以图表的形式展示,如柱状图、折线图等,方便用户直观地了解艺术品市场的情况。
- 数据分析:基于统计数据,进行简单的数据分析,如艺术品市场的发展趋势分析、热门艺术品的分析等。这些分析结果可以为艺术品商家、收藏者等提供决策参考。
五、拟解决的主要问题
- 信息不完整与不准确问题:艺术品市场信息繁杂,来源多样,在系统设计中要建立严格的信息审核机制,确保录入的艺术品信息完整、准确。例如,通过要求商家提供多方面的证明材料来核实艺术品的基本信息,防止虚假信息的录入。
- 用户隐私与安全问题:由于涉及用户的个人信息以及艺术品的交易等敏感信息,系统需要采用加密技术、访问控制等手段来保护用户隐私和数据安全。如采用SSL加密协议对用户登录和交易过程中的数据进行加密传输,防止信息泄露。
- 分类混乱问题:艺术品的分类标准存在多种,容易造成分类混乱的情况。要建立统一且灵活的分类体系,既能满足不同用户的查询需求,又能保证分类的科学性和合理性。例如,通过建立分类层次结构,让用户可以从不同维度对艺术品进行分类查询。
六、研究方案
- 需求分析阶段:
- 通过市场调研、问卷调查、访谈等方式,收集艺术品商家、收藏者、鉴定者等不同用户对艺术品信息管理系统的需求。例如,对多家艺术品交易公司进行访谈,了解他们在艺术品管理过程中遇到的问题以及对系统功能的期望。
- 分析现有艺术品管理方式的优缺点,找出存在的问题和改进的方向。对一些传统的艺术品管理数据库进行研究,总结其在信息存储、查询、管理等方面的不足之处。
- 系统设计阶段:
- 根据需求分析的结果,进行系统架构设计。确定系统的整体框架,包括各个功能模块的划分、模块之间的接口关系等。例如,采用分层架构模式,将系统分为表现层、业务逻辑层和数据访问层,提高系统的可维护性和扩展性。
- 进行数据库设计,确定数据库的结构和数据表的关系。根据艺术品信息、用户信息、交易信息等不同类型的数据,设计相应的数据表,如艺术品信息表包含艺术品的名称、作者、类别等字段。
- 系统实现阶段:
- 选择合适的开发技术和工具,如编程语言(Java、Python等)、数据库管理系统(MySQL、Oracle等)、前端开发框架(Vue.js 、React等)等,进行系统的开发。例如,采用Java作为后端开发语言,MySQL作为数据库管理系统,Vue.js 作为前端开发框架,实现系统的功能。
- 进行代码编写和测试,确保系统的功能正确性和稳定性。在编写代码过程中,采用单元测试、集成测试等测试方法,及时发现和解决代码中的问题。
- 系统测试与优化阶段:
- 对系统进行全面的测试,包括功能测试、性能测试、安全测试等。功能测试主要验证系统的各项功能是否满足需求;性能测试评估系统的响应速度、吞吐量等性能指标;安全测试检查系统的安全性,如用户认证、数据加密等方面是否存在漏洞。
- 根据测试结果,对系统进行优化和改进。如果发现系统存在性能瓶颈,通过优化算法、调整数据库结构等方式提高系统的性能;如果存在安全漏洞,则及时修复漏洞,加强系统的安全性。
七、预期成果
- 系统原型:开发出一个完整的艺术品信息管理系统原型,具备用户管理、艺术品管理、艺术品分类、统计中心等功能。该原型能够稳定运行,满足基本的业务需求。
- 研究报告:撰写详细的研究报告,包括系统的需求分析、设计思路、实现过程、测试结果等内容。报告要对系统的功能和性能进行全面的分析和总结,阐述系统的优势和不足之处,并提出改进的建议。
- 用户手册:编制用户手册,详细介绍艺术品信息管理系统的使用方法,包括用户注册、登录、艺术品信息查询、交易操作、统计中心使用等功能的操作步骤。用户手册要简洁明了,方便用户使用系统。
进度安排:
(1)2024.02.01-2024.02.25:查阅资料,分析系统功能,明确并理解课题任务,提交开题报告;
(2)2024.02.26-2024.03.15:进行需求分析及概要设计和详细设计并形成相关文档;
(3)2024.03.16-2024.04.01:进行用户界面设计以及开始编码的实现,并形成相关文档;
(4)2024.04.02-2024.04.15:对系统作进一步功能完善并优化,能实现较完整的功能;且准备论文撰写工作,月底前提交论文大纲;
(5)2024.04.16-2024.05.01:完善设计、撰写论文,修改论文,提交论文初稿;
(6)2024.05.02-2024.05.15:论文定稿;准备答辩
参考文献:
[1] 杨承新. 基于java的网络安全管理系统V1.0. 湖北省, 武汉东湖学院, 2022-01-01。
[2] 庄帅. 内容管理系统的实现[J]. 信息系统工程, 2022, (08): 101-104。
[3] 黄园媛, 廖卓凡, 吴宏林. 有效开展Java程序设计线上教学方法探索[J]. 计算机时代, 2021, (01): 99-101。
[4] 木啸林, 牛坤龙, 蔡世荣, 杨现坤, 王晋年. 开源网络地理信息系统的技术体系与研究进展[J]. 计算机工程与应用, 2022, 58 (15): 37-51。
[5] 杨士永. 基于Java的对象存储管理系统的设计与实现[J]. 电子技术与软件工程, 2022, (04): 253-257。
[6] 龙丹, 刘欣, 杨呈永. 基于应用型人才培养的Java综合实训课程教学改革研究[J]. 电脑知识与技术, 2023, 19 (14): 131-133。
[7] 余亚杰. 基于Java的web前端设计管理系统. 湖北省, 武汉东湖学院, 2021-02-01。
[8] 张浩博. 基于Java的计算机技术开发研究管理系统V1.0. 湖北省, 武汉东湖学院, 2021-07-01。
[9] 荀丽丹, 刘娴. 基于大数据的计算机数据库连接访问技术研究[J]. 信息与电脑(理论版), 2021, 33 (01): 158-160。
[10] 孙丽红. Java开发综合实训中开展课程思政教学模式研究与实践[J]. 中国新通信, 2022, 24 (22): 118-120。
[11] 黄秀丽, 陈志. 基于JSON的异构Web平台的设计与实现[J]. 计算机技术与发展, 2021, 31 (03): 120-125。
[12] 朱向阳. 基于Java的一体化加工自动归档平台设计[J]. 华北理工大学学报(自然科学版), 2022, 44 (02): 106-113+120。
[13] 黄志超. Java程序设计课程改革[J]. 电脑知识与技术, 2021, 17 (25): 202-204。
[14] 王日磊, 陈奎, 张娜娜. 基于JAVA EE和面向服务架构技术的系统设计与实现[J]. 企业科技与发展, 2022, (12): 50-52。
以上是开题是根据本选题撰写,是项目程序开发之前开题报告内容,后期程序可能存在大改动。最终成品以下面运行环境+技术+界面为准,可以酌情参考使用开题的内容。要本源码参考请在文末进行获取!!
系统部署环境:
数据库:MySQL 5.7
开发工具:Eclipse或IntelliJ IDEA
运行环境和构建工具:Tomcat 7.0、JDK 1.8、Maven 3.3.9
前端技术:HTML、CSS、JavaScript (JS)、Vue.js:
后端技术:Java、Spring、MyBatis、springmvc Maven